Research Assistant: Environmental Impacts of China’s Belt & Road Initiative

Based on the Global Chinese Development Finance Dataset Version 2.0, AidData’s Chinese Development Finance Program is conducting research on the environmental impacts of BRI projects. This includes evaluating whether proximity to coal-fired power plants, transmission lines, or highways adversely affects public health outcomes of local communities, hampers biodiversity, or causes significant deforestation.
